For endurance cyclists Gokul Krishna and Raman Garimella, a hundred-kilometre ride is a walk in the park. Literally.
Gokul and Raman, both of whom are from Hyderabad, pursued their passion for cycling in their own unique ways. They have also cycled together and worked together. They now bring their collective experience to a book called "Escape Velocity: The Definitive Desi Guide to Cycling" for anyone who is a cycling newbie. In this episode, they talk about their book, their cycling adventures; and which desi cyclist's story is complete without a shout-out to Jo Jeeta Wohi Sikandar, Maga Maharaju, Race 3 and Srimanthudu?

In this episode, we talk about the 2002 Telugu blockbuster, Indra, that starred Chiranjeevi and was directed by B Gopal. Join us in a retrospective of this wildly successful movie of the factionist genre.
Direction: B. Gopal
Writing: Chinni Krishna; Paruchuri Brothers
Starring: Chiranjeevi; Sonali Bendre; Arti Aggarwal
